Output b9867fe703e24394dfe62faddb3c63c5f1612b14027bde31a9ecae9770779ec0:5

value
44453499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5730e4c5a1366443d2d8372561aedcd83b7473c7 OP_EQUAL
address
MFrBbJtCUota8aa26zLEDB1fVWuUXWoqWa
transaction
b9867fe703e24394dfe62faddb3c63c5f1612b14027bde31a9ecae9770779ec0
spent
true